What makes a website awesome?

What makes a website awesome?

Having a website for your business today is essential. However, it’s now not just enough to have a website and show that you have a web presence with your contact number on, you need a lot more than that for a successful business. You need to have an awesome website, one that makes you stand out from the crowd and one that not only complements your business but sells it. So what makes a website awesome?

Make a good first impression

This is the first rule because it’s the first thing that matters. Studies have shown that people only take 5-8 seconds to decide if they're going to stay on a website or not. So that doesn't give you long to make a good impression. To have an awesome website, you need to make it captivating, make people want to stay and tell them how you can help them! But at the same time, you really don’t want to overwhelm or confuse visitors to your site as this might cause them to leave, so you need to find the balance.

Make your text readable

You're likely to have some text on your site to describe your business and your products and services. For your website to be awesome, you need your text to be formatted properly so that visitors can read and digest the information easily. Make sure you have easy to read typography and fonts, short and sweet texts, bullet points and lists and make sure there is a decent amount of spacing between paragraphs and sentences. It's also important to include proper headings and use a call to action and make sure that your message gets across effectively. You can check you have this right by doing click testing which can really help to make better, more informed design decisions when developing a new page.

Optimize your site

Today, more and more people are viewing websites via their mobile phones; they look at things on the go. So, you need to make sure that your website is optimized for mobile use; otherwise, you will alienate a large number of people, and this is no good for business.

Make sure its responsive

Not only does your site need to be optimized for smartphones and other mobile devices, but it also needs to be as responsive as it would be if it were to be viewed and used on a laptop or PC at home. Make sure it's just as quick and effective so that anyone can access your website whenever they need to.

Make it sophisticated yet simple

The more sophisticated the design of your website is, the more smooth and sleek it will be to your potential customers. Having a simple design makes things easier for the viewer and will make a larger impact. There are loads of designs and layouts you can look at to inspire you, and if you have a look at different websites yourself, you will see which ones look messy and which ones you find simple and easy to navigate around. Which ones make you interested in finding out more? Which ones make you want to buy? Do your research so that you know what works, what you like, and what makes you want more.

Choose ads wisely

One of the best ways to make money from your website is through ad revenue, however, if you have a website full of adverts and with ads popping up everywhere, then it is not only bad for SEO purposes, but it is also quite annoying for visitors to your site, and they won't stay there very long. The more adverts you have in inconvenient places on your site, the less likely people will be to return to your website in the future. You should also be careful only to choose advertisers who are relevant or complement your site.

Invest in imagery

Many people overlook how important imagery is on their websites. It's really important to have high-resolution imagery, and as much as you might want to use your own original images instead of stock photography, you need to be very confident in your photography skills to do that as you can't just expect to snap a photo on your phone and have it look good on your site. However, when it comes to stock photography, you also don't want to have the same images that everyone else has on their sites. So, it's important to be creative, think about what works for you and your business and choose accordingly and invest in your imagery if you want the best results.

Include a call to action

As we know, users have short attention spans, and they don't want your website to be hard work. So, with this in mind, if you want your website to be awesome, then you need to tell your customers what to do and where to click. If they don't know where to go or how you can help them, then they will probably just leave the site and go elsewhere. Make sure that it's clearly stated on the site what action you want the user to take. Include a call to action such as “Buy now”, “Request information”, “Add to Cart” as these will increase the conversions on your site. Make sure that you don't overdo it though as this will also annoy your visitors, but at the same time make sure that you have 'call to actions' throughout the site and not just on the main page. 

 If you make sure that you do these key things, then you'll be on your way to having an awesome website, one that will set you apart from the competition and show your business in the best light possible. Remember, your website these days is just like your shop window, so that first impression has to be good.
